Your red cell count is going to go down because you’ve lost a pint of blood to the donation process. Your body kicks in thinking it needs more oxygen and red cells because this is a lot of blood to lose in a short period of time. read more
A reticulocyte count may be done if a child has a low number of red blood cells, called anemia. The reticulocyte count can help doctors know if the bone marrow is appropriately working to make new red blood cells. read more
